Abstract

Dispositif pour nettoyer une surface optique Dispositif (5) comportant :- une surface optique (10) transparente,- une unité de nettoyage (15) de la surface optique comportant une couche piézoélectrique (20) et au moins deux transducteurs d’onde (45), chaque transducteur d’onde comportant des électrodes (40) de polarité opposée au contact de la couche piézoélectrique et étant couplé acoustiquement avec la surface optique pour générer au moins une onde ultrasonore de surface (WS) ou une onde de Lamb (WL) se propageant dans la surface optique, les transducteurs étant en outre disposés en périphérie de la surface optique.
